how many of you actually use the "surround lighting" function? since the front fog lights, side lamps and licence plate light comes on every time you lock and unlock the car...up to 40 sec...will it affect the battery life span? appreciate comments and suggestions from out senior bros...cheers :whistle:

haha..i so get that very often..excuse me sir but i think you forgot to turn of your headlights. I would give a gentle smile and say..thanks but the car knows how to turn it off itself, and i walk away turning back. My gf would often turn ard to see what happens. Apparently people just stand to wait and see if it does go off by itself. Lol. Guess its a cool feature and i doubt it uses much of the batt. The lights were meant for walking you back safely when u park in a dark place. Real cool feature.
